Practically everything we do in life will affect someone else whether we want it to or not. Our impacts and impressions may be good, bad or indifferent but we cannot prevent them from occurring. The results from all of our interactions can be immediate or have consequences that we are never aware of. Preparing ourselves for our involvement with others is very important since we always leave something behind. One way to prepare is to raise our awareness and understanding regarding how our lives have so much meaning to each other. Then maybe we can increase the percentage of having a positive outcome with all those we come in contact with. A way to effectively accomplish this is by observing our lives through various stories to see the value of how our life actions interconnect with each other. Evaluating the ways we participate in relationships can also be effective by indicating where we can make improvements. This book is dedicated to offering various ways to reflect on how you see yourself and others in our everyday dealings with people. I hope you will be encouraged, inspired and motivated as a result of reading these stories. The idea would be to completely digest the stories as you read them without feeling the need to rush through the book.
